Welcome to Springs and Things, the podcast where two close friends spill the tea on all things Colorado Springs! From culture and community to hidden gems and neighborhood lore, we’ve got it covered. Join us as we sip our coffee (or maybe something stronger) and dive into the stories and secrets that make this city so unique. Frequently Asked Questions About Springs and Things

What is Springs and Things about and what kind of topics does it cover?

This podcast provides engaging discussions centered around the culture, community, and hidden gems of Colorado Springs. Each episode features lively conversations that cover a wide range of topics, including local events, culinary delights, artistic endeavors, and significant community initiatives. The hosts, who share a strong friendship, bring a fun and relatable vibe, often sharing personal anecdotes and insights that resonate with both locals and newcomers alike. The podcast aims to illuminate aspects of Colorado Springs that many might overlook, fostering a sense of connection and exploration among its listeners.
